
Richard Allen Glover, age 59, of Mannington, WV passed away on Sunday, January 13, 2019 at UPMC-Montefiore Hospital in Pittsburgh, PA. He was born July 23, 1959 in Fairmont, WV, a son of Richard Lee “Ipp” Glover and his wife Libby and the late Janice Kay Yoho Glover.
In addition to his father, Richard is survived by his wife Cathy Mary Noshagya Glover of Mannington, WV with whom he was married to for 35 years having wed on December 3, 1983; three children, Michael A. Glover and wife Sarah Ripoli Glover and their daughter Delaney Glover of Hurdle Mills, NC, Christy J. Glover Richardson and husband Mitchell and their daughter Reese Richardson of Fairmont, and Garrett A. Glover and great friend Timothy Ray of Morgantown; one brother, Roger L. Glover of Rachel, WV; 5 step-siblings, Cheri and Michael Hays of Mannington, Tonya and Larry Lodge of Mannington, Bo and Amy Metz of Morgantown, Joni and John Latocha of Mannington, and Jamie and Dan Trowbridge of Mannington; several nieces and nephews.
Richard was a Mannington High School graduate, Class of 1977. He played on the 1977 State Champion Football team and also played basketball. He was very active in the Mannington Elks Lodge having served as ER. He volunteered and raised money for veterans, children, and local schools. He coached little league baseball from T-Ball to Senior. He also coached Pop Warner football (Idamay and Mannington). He enjoyed watching WVU football and basketball. He worked for the Marion County Board of Education for 21 years as a caretaker of East-West Stadium and also as a painter. He loved all High School sports.
